Junior High School Teachers’ Competence in Developing 2013 Curriculum Learning Materials Ananda, Rusydi; Ritonga, Maharani Sartika; Daulay, Aidil Ridwan; Anggraini, Pauli; Abdi, Hasnan; Harahap, Addurun Nafis; Ritonga, Mashabi M. Noor

Abstract

Due to technological advancements, educators must choose effective teaching materials that meet students' developmental needs. The purpose of this study is to evaluate teachers' capacity to create instructional materials for the 2013 curriculum at SMP IT Raudlatul Jannah Gayo Lues in Aceh. This study employs a qualitative methodology and a descriptive study design. Data gathering methods include observation, interviews, and documentation studies. After data analysis using data reduction techniques, conclusions are drawn by presenting the data. After passing a triangulation methodology test to ensure that the findings (research data) matched at least three different methods and data sources, the data was deemed genuine (informants). The study's findings revealed that: (1) the teacher's ability to plan a productive week by keeping track of the academic calendar; (2) the teacher's ability to put together an annual program (prota) in accordance with the curriculum and instructional materials; (3) the teacher's ability to set up semester programs in accordance with efficient study hours to meet the completion goals for each basic competency (KD) subject; and (4) the teacher's ability to create lesson plans (RPP). As a result, it was determined that the ability of the teachers at Raudlatul Jannah Gayo Lues Middle School to create learning resources was effective and good in accordance with the school's vision, mission, and goals.
Improvements in Al-Qur'an Letter Reading for Children with Minor Mental Disabilities Using the Bil Hikmah Methods Tanjung, Lidra Agustina; Siahaan, Amiruddin; Daulay, Aidil Ridwan; Harahap, Fiki Robi Handoko; Sartika, Maharani; Hafiz, Muhammad; Akbar, Sabila; Siregar, Vera Yunita; Azhar, Muhammad

Abstract

Al-Qur'an is primary literacy for Muslims, including elementary age children. Likewise, for mentally retarded children the ability to read the Koran still leaves its own problems. This study aims to describe efforts to improve the ability to read the letters of the Qur'an for children with mild mental retardation through the bil hikmah method. The setting of this research was in Class VII C of the Batubara State SLB, where in this class there were three mild mentally retarded children with the initials MRF, ZM and K with different characteristics. The research will be conducted using classroom action research methods. This research was conducted in collaboration with teachers. This research was conducted in 2 cycles. Each cycle starts from the stages of planning, implementing actions, observing and reflecting. The results of the research are described in narrative and graphical form from the process to the improvement results in cycle II. In the first cycle the children obtained MRF and ZM results of 65% and K 60% and the results in the second cycle of MRF, ZM and K were 85%. This shows that the bil Hikmah method is effectively used to improve the ability to read Al-Quran letters for children with mild mental retardation.
